摘 要:《软件工程》是计算机科学与技术专业的核心专业课程。其目标是培养学生软件分析设计和工程实践能力。针对存在的学生理论不扎实,分析设计能力差,工程规范习惯缺少等问题,山东理工大学"软件工程"教学团队,积极探索过程性评价机制,探索有效的成绩分析办法。通过对计科专业三个年级的持续实施,过程性评价机制较好的达到了预期目标。"Software engineering" is one of the core professional courses of computer science and technology. The goal is to cultivate students" ability in software analysis and design and engineering practice. In view of the existing problems such as unsound theory, poor analysis and design ability, lack of engineering norms and habits, one examination reform was carried out by the "Software Engineering" teaching group of SDUT, to explore the process evaluation mechanism and the effective analysis method of performance analysis. Through the continuous implementation of 3 grades, the mechanism has achieved the desired goal.
